Just some tips to enjoy your FF membership --- you're paying php2,500 to 3,600 (depending on your membership details)a month so it's better you get your money's worth. Here goes:

1. For a 30-day month, make sure you'd allot AT LEAST 20 days for your gym sessions. Say you're paying 2, 900 monthly, that would make it Php145 per day. Not bad. If you can have more days, the better.

2. Time management. It is normally open from 6AM to 10PM, you've got more than 12 hours to fit in whatever schedule you have.  Having no time is a lame excuse really for gym goers. Make time for it, c'mon. Think of the amount you're paying, that's enough ' conditioning' to push yourself to be at FF.

3. Maximize use. I attend yoga classes at FF Manila. How much is a yoga session outside FF? At a minimum, Php350-500. For 3 yoga sessions I attend every week, I should be paying 1050-1500, But at  FF, FREE or part of your monthly fee. There are several GX you can join, go for them! All of them may be beneficial to your flexibility, strength, stability and vitality. As added bonus, GXs allow you to meet new friends ( of course, you are not really there to add up your friends' list on FB, but c'mon, loosen up, there's nothing wrong about gaining new friends). 

4. Shower. Sauna. Spa. Free flowing coffee and all other amenities applicable to your membership details. AVAIL, USE THEM ALL. Feel at home really. Don't be shy and don't mind what other people would say. As long as you don't step on somebody's mat or toes, nobody would really bother you. You can even sleep at the couches. Use the PCs for internet or if you have your own gadget, enjoy the wifi. MAKE IT YOUR HOWN. BE AT HOME. (I am sure you know the parameters, I know that whenever you go, you will always bring your good manners. Feeling at home doesn't mean you have to throw away inhibitions or proper decorum).

5. This is most important, GET INTO A PROGRAM. Know your goals, you cannot just go there without an objective. If you cannot afford a PT (like I do), research for a program that will suit your needs/goals. Don't be afraid to experiment, to push yourself and don't mind looking goofy doing those sets you learned from internet. (If you cannot research, ASK QUESTIONS from a PT, you will not be charged for that. You may also ask other members to determine if you're doing the right thing, just DON'T ASK FOR THEIR NUMBERS AFTERWARDS. )   Knowing your goals will set your focus. Keeping your focus will set your targets. Meeting your targets set results. Getting results make you one happy person. JUST DON'T FORGET TO HAVE FUN WHILE DOING ALL THOSE REPS. Be serious about your program but please don't die on the floor --- so have fun. Make yourself enjoy whatever you're doing and eventually, YOU WILL LOVE YOURSELF.

6. LEARN TO GIVE IN AND SHARE. If you don't want to have friends, at least, have some courtesy to other members. Share that squat rack, those dumbbells, those benches. Don't be arrogant or braggart. Feeling at home doesn't mean the place is all yours. Grab a dictionary and find the word 'ALTERNATE' so that you wouldn't give a blank look if someone approaches to alternate with you. Maintaining a good relationship with other members and staff, including maintenance and security guards will make your stay more comfortable, worthwhile and yes, enjoyable.

Enjoy!
